The installation marks a significant step in Covestro’s journey toward climate neutrality by 2035.
In a major stride toward industrial decarbonization, thyssenkrupp Uhde has successfully delivered and commissioned its advanced EnviNOx® technology at Covestro’s Baytown site in Texas, USA. The cutting-edge emissions control system is central to Covestro’s Nitric Acid Unit Climate Initiative (NAUCI), which is projected to reduce greenhouse gas emissions by around 154,000 metric tons of CO2 equivalents per year. This development highlights both companies’ ongoing commitment to sustainable operations and climate protection.
The EnviNOx® installation at Baytown represents another chapter in the long-standing collaboration between thyssenkrupp Uhde and Covestro. The technology has already been deployed at multiple Covestro facilities worldwide, including Shanghai, where it has demonstrated significant reductions in nitrous oxide (N2O) and nitrogen oxide (NOx) emissions. By adopting this proven solution at its Baytown site, Covestro is reinforcing its strategy to minimize environmental impacts across its global production network.

At the Baytown facility, the EnviNOx® solution has been integrated into the tail gas system of nitric acid production. The system combines a tertiary abatement approach—treating emissions in the tail gas—with a secondary abatement measure located below the ammonia oxidation gauzes. This dual approach maximizes efficiency and ensures high levels of nitrous oxide reduction.
Globally, EnviNOx® has a track record spanning over two decades, with more than 60 units installed. Collectively, these systems have prevented more than 260 million tons of CO2-equivalent emissions, making the technology one of the most effective climate action tools available to the chemical industry. Capable of reducing up to 99% of N2O and NOx emissions, the system is versatile enough to be applied not only in nitric acid plants but also in other high-emission processes such as caprolactam, adipic acid, and ammonia cracking production.
